Remote Voltage Selector
for Iota DLS Battery Charger/Converters
The manual VS-2 VOLTSELECT switch is designed for manual control of the output voltage of the DLS series converter/chargers. When in the HIGH position, the DLS charger will deliver 14.vdc at light loads and 14.0vdc at full load. When in the LOW position, The DLS charger will deliver 13.6vdc at light loads and 13.4vdc at full load. After charging on the HIGH position, be sure to switch back to LOW to reduce overcharging and battery water loss.
The LOW 13.6 volt float voltage is designed for long term charging. 13.6vdc is below the gassing point of most 12 volt lead acid batteries. This will keep battery water loss at a minimum. 13.6vdc is also the preferred voltage for longer life of fan motors, pumps, and lights.
The HIGH 14.2 volt setting is designed for customers who want to quickly and completely re-charge their battery or batteries. This can be used just before taking a trip (to "top off" the batteries), or used when running the generator to reduce generator run time. Be sure and switch back to LOW after charging to reduce overcharging and battery water loss.
6" leads are included with the VS-2. Attach additional wiring to remote mount the switch in a convenient location. Attach the Voltselect wires to the left and right screws on the terminal block located between the DC output lugs and the shoreline cord. It makes no difference which wire is hooked up to which terminal. Click thumbnail image below for connections.
NOTE: Voltage values referenced above are for 12VDC controller. 24V values are approximately double these values.
